In Celebration of

Sheila Summers (nee Tushingham)

June 26, 1940 -  February 15, 2021

It is with great love and memories that the family shares the passing of Sheila on Monday, February 15th, 2021 at the age of 80 years. Beloved wife of the late Robin Summers, loving mother of Susan, Wendy, Jennifer and her partner. Cherished grandma of Christopher, Michael, Taiva, Alysha ,Alfredo and Takiya. Sheila will be lovingly remembered by her son in law Claudio Spagnuolo and brother in law Richard Summers and extended family and friends. She was a life time member of the Doberman Pincer Club of Canada and the Canadian Kennel Club of Canada. She was a high school English teacher at Richview Collegiate Institute in Etobicoke for many years and loved by many of her students. Sheila was a fixture in the Richmond Gardens area of Etobicoke since 1970. She will be sadly missed by all who knew her. As per current restrictions, there will be no funeral but a celebration of life in the future. If desired, a memorial donation would be gratefully appreciated to Doberman Rescue
